25-year-old dies of electrocution in Syangja



WALING: A 25-year-old man died of electrocution in Putalibazar-9, Kolma, on Saturday afternoon.

According to Syangja District Police Office Spokesperson Prasanna Raj Chaudhary, the deceased has been identified as Arun Kumar Chaudhary of Rangpur, Gujra Municipality-1, Rautahat. He had been working with Pokhara Fiber Net.

Chaudhary, who had been living in a rented room at Thadoline in Putalibazar-1, was injured while climbing an electricity pole for internet maintenance. The aluminum ladder he used came into contact with a live wire.

He succumbed to his injuries while undergoing treatment. Police said an investigation into the incident has been initiated.
